KF-6115
KF-6115
Silicone alkyl chain co-variable polyglycerol modified silicone surfactant. Excellent adsorption to pigment surfaces and solubility in both silicone fluid and oils, making it useful as an excellent dispersant for pigments in various oil agents. HLB: Low

KSG-042Z
KSG-042Z
- The use of isododecane as the base oil and its three-dimensional cross-linked structure of fine particles imparts a smooth, silky feel and creates a matte effect.
- It has excellent swelling properties for both silicone fluid and hydrocarbon oil, improving the stability of cosmetic products.
KSG-045Z
KSG-045Z
- KF-995 (cyclopentasiloxane) is used as the base oil.
- Its fine particles with a three-dimensional cross-linked structure impart a smooth, silky feel and create a matte effect.
- It has excellent swelling properties for both silicone fluid and hydrocarbon oil, improving the stability of cosmetic products.
KSG-048Z
KSG-048Z
- KF-96A-2CS (volatile dimethicone) is used as the base oil.
- Due to its three-dimensional cross-linked structure and fine particles, it imparts a smooth, silky feel and creates a matte effect.
- It has excellent swelling properties for both silicone fluid and hydrocarbon oil, improving the stability of cosmetic products.
